A very well presented and spacious three bedroom semi-detached house situated within a very convenient location in proximity to Kenley Station and Bourne Park.
Set back from the road, this larger than average family home has been updated by the current owners to include an open plan kitchen/diner with a utility room, conservatory and additional shower room.
On entry you are presented with the hallway leading to the 18ft lounge with a feature brick fireplace and bay window to the front. There is a modern open plan kitchen/diner with dual colour Shaker style cabinets with built in double oven and stylish extractor hood, induction hob and a complimentary wood work top and has the benefit of a utility room. Adjoining the kitchen is a stunning bright and spacious conservatory overlooking the garden. To complete the downstairs accommodation is a recently installed shower room.
Upstairs there are three bedrooms, two double bedrooms with built in wardrobes and a larger and average third bedroom, a modern family bathroom with a curved back to the wall bath and vanity cupboard with inset basin plus a separate W/C.
Externally, there is a patio area leading to the garden which is mainly laid to lawn with a pathway leading to a further paved patio area ideal for al fresco entertaining and fenced to all sides. The driveway to the front provides parking for several vehicles and leads to a tandom garage to the rear.
Kenley Station is a short distance away providing access to both London Bridge and Victoria Station and Blackfriars via Purley Station using Thames Link plus the 407 bus route to Croydon/Caterham accessed on Godstone Road.
There are several sought after local schools for all ages within the vicinity including Harris Academy, The Hayes School and Riddlesdown Collegiate. Riddlesdown Common and Kenley Aerodrome and Common are also nearby and provide miles of open space and country walks. There are further leisure amenities locally including a number of golf clubs, sports clubs and gyms including the de Stafford sports centre in Caterham.
There is a small selection of shops in the Kenley Parade however for a more comprehensive selection, Purley Town is just over a mile away. The M25 Junction 6 is a short distance away providing access to both Gatwick and Heathrow airports plus the motorway network
